Again in the day, should you had been establishing a automotive with non-inventory carburetors or a modified fuel injection system and needed to dial it in, you used previous-college methods. If it made your eyes water, it was too wealthy. If it backfired, it was too lean. You could possibly also verify the spark plug and tail pipe color for indications of rich and lean operating, but these have been averages over time, not prompt snapshots of a particular throttle setting. Race shops had dynamometers and exhaust gas analyzers that might immediately measure the richness of the mixture below sure load circumstances, however a do-it-yourselfer didn’t have entry to such tools. Then, within the mid-1970s, Heathkit came out with the CI-1080, a portable exhaust gas analyzer marketed to DIY-ers. It was a revelation. Out of the blue, the yard mechanic had access to a instrument that may very well be used to directly measure the percentage of carbon monoxide in the exhaust, which is closely associated to the air/gasoline mixture.


Some processes require measurement of very low levels of Oxygen in the part-per-million (ppm) vary. Special sorts of electrochemical sensors can be used for this objective. The basic operation of this sensor is much like the p.c Oxygen sensors mentioned above. As oxygen molecules are interested in sturdy magnetic fields, paramagnetic oxygen analyzers utilize a sampling system that comprises nitrogen-stuffed spheres suspended inside a magnetic area. Oxygen in the area can be attracted to the magnetic area, and the spheres will transfer proportionally to the oxygen concentration.
